Our client, one of Scotland’s specialist manufacturers of Precision Machined Engineering components, is looking for experienced, professional CNC Programmer/Setter/Operators for their Turning and Grinding CNC Machines or a Surface Grinder.
The roles require applicants who have the ability to look at technical drawings, CAD drawings, and who are able to programme, set and operate CNC Turning or Grinding equipment or a good surface Grinder. Our client requires CNC Machinists to work from their facility in Motherwell. Applicants should come from a light, precision, CNC Turning or Grinding (Cylindrical or Surface) or Toolroom engineering background to produce industrial components to a tight tolerance. The role will involve working on CNC machines to produce low volume or batch components, ranging from one off to two hundred. Programming experience is essential, and Manual Surface Grinding knowledge, as well as experience in using CNC or Manual Turning or Grinding machines, would be an advantage.
Applicants will preferably have present or previous Toolmaking, precision CNC Turning or CNC Grinding or Manual machining experience, machining small to large batch components and working in small batches. However, applicants with CNC experience within a Machine Shop or Toolroom environment would also be ideal, as long as they are comfortable working to tight tolerances. Personality is important to our client, who believes in a good working team environment, enabling both personnel and career growth. They seek someone who is passionate about CNC Turning or CNC/Manual Grinding.
Work pattern is Monday to Friday with an early finish on Fridays. Overtime will also be available and paid at enhanced rates. You will receive a competitive salary of between £37-41K basic depending on experience, along with overtime, a pension scheme, and holiday.
